Who is a Master in Public Management?

Master in Public Management will be able to deal with such situations as working with the public and creating various plans that will help the company to make their future projects more or less focused towards the consumer.

What are the main duties of a Master in Public Management?

Public Management degree will allow them to talk to the people via different types of communication. They might use the online feedback forms, surveys or even make small studies to find out about the things they need. Afterwards, the specialist processes the existing information and creates a plan that will slightly or dramatically change the way a company will work in the close future.

Where can a Master in Public Management find a career?

Public administration and management professionals are needed everywhere. For example, they work at the hospitals to find out about the quality of the service that the patients get from the clinic, or they work at large stores getting feedback of the ordering process. They work online helping the website grow by researching the readers taste and changing the content of the platform.
